"Set within the Lido Marina Village retail complex, this hybrid bottle shop and gastropub is housed in a cool, all-black building facing the marina. Decor is polished, with warm woods, black accents, and brass flatware; there's a small patio that overlooks the bay. You'll see date-nighters and friend groups, all of whom flock here for chef Joel Harrington's farm-to-table small plates, like charred eggplant hummus, curried beef meatballs with mint yogurt, and a can't-miss burrata with roasted squash, candied pistachios, and pomegranate." - Archana Ram

We came in for dinner on Saturday night. Reservation recommended since it's quite popular. The restaurant has a casual lively vibe, but it's a bit too loud and noisy to be able to carry a conversation. The menu is rather short but offers some good entree options such as crispy salmon and venison. The service was attentive and friendly. 1 hour free parking is available with validation, but you'll have to pay extra of you stay for more than an hour.
